Hi all,
Let's try one more time to get this merged.
Another series, introducing the Berlin nand support, depends on this.
This series was part of a bigger one[1], which was split into smaller ones as asked by Ezequiel[2]. When we take this into account, this is v8.
The aim here is to use the nand framework to setup the timings, while keeping the old in-driver way of configuration timings for compatibility reasons.

Since v2: - Added back the support for keep-config 16 bits devices - Fixed wrong unit in a calculation - Reworked the pxa3xx_nand_init_timings() logic - Allowed compile test the pxa3xx driver
Since v1: - Rebased on top of v4.2-rc1
Since the series was split up: - Reworked the ndcr setup - Removed the read_id_bytes update after device detection
Antoine Tenart (4): mtd: nand: allow compile test of MTD_NAND_PXA3xx mtd: pxa3xx_nand: add helpers to setup the timings mtd: pxa3xx_nand: rework flash detection and timing setup mtd: pxa3xx_nand: clean up the pxa3xx timings
